PolitiFact: Democratic telemarketers called petition signers (WI Democratic Recall petition signers)
Milwaukee Journal-Sentinel ^ | 5/18/2011 | Tom Kertscher

Posted on 05/18/2011 7:48:47 AM PDT by UB355

Says people who signed recall petitions against Wisconsin state Sen. Jim Holperin received "harassing phone calls from out-of-state telemarketers claiming to represent the Democratic Party and insinuating foul play by petition circulators."

If the GAB has not completed its review of the petitions, why does anyone outside of the GAB know who signed them?

All petitions are posted on the GAB website in PDF format, the individual pages appear to be JPGs and are not editable as such. They have been available since shortly after they were filed with the GAB.

Each recall drive is presented as a separate case so it is not necessary to sift through the whole pile if you are looking for a particular recall effort.
